MITRE encourages employees to take an active interest in civic and community affairs by volunteering. Additionally, the company coordinates charitable campaigns and donation drives throughout the year to help our employees meet their philanthropic goals.

  • MITRE employees make an effort to volunteer their time in support of our sponsors, particularly those in the armed services. MITRE's Suits for Vets program, for example, provides suits, shirts, ties, and accessories for wounded former soldiers who have left active military service and are starting new careers. In 2009, the Massachusetts Employer Support to the Guard and Reserve (ESGR) presented MITRE with its "Above and Beyond" award for its many initiatives for the support of veterans in and out of its workplace.
  • Throughout the year, MITRE's two principal locations and sites host a variety of efforts to provide for those less fortunate, including the Salvation Army Angel Trees that offer employees the opportunity to provide holiday gifts to needy families and other donation drives.
  • Each year, MITRE donates its used and excess computers and other equipment to educational institutions and charities.
